Home Prices in Westminster, CA
The median home value in Westminster, CA is $1,104,016 as of mid-2026, according to Zillow's Home Value Index (ZHVI).That's up 3.3% compared to a year ago and up 3.1% from two years prior.
Compared to the U.S. national median of $410,000, homes in Westminster are priced169% above average. Westminster is part of the Los Angeles-Long Beach-Anaheim, CA metro area.
Over the past five years, Westminster home values have risen by approximately35.8%, reflecting strong long-term appreciation in this market.
